		<description>Maria,

Rest assured that the text conversion will work.  This is a standard feature on all equipment utilising the Anoto dot pattern frame work. 

Having said that, each company that uses Anoto is different and will manage the dictionaries and databases differently.

For example, in our systems, we recognise printing and cursive writing - and to increase accuracy of conversion, we also apply specific dictionaries that are relevant to the industry that we are working with. So if we are working with a construction company, we add into the dictionary terms that used in construction. This improves the accuracy of the hand writing recognition hugely.

Livescribe might make different dictionaries available over time - so if you are taking notes in a physics class, it will be more accurate in the conversion if there is a dictionary designed for that application.</description>
